Likelihood to Recommend StackAdapt seems to work really well for niche audiences that might be hard to reach in Google display
ADS . For example, we have a client in the welding industry that sells products to multiple fairly small audiences, like welding schools. We can create and target these small audiences by combining ABM audiences, uploaded lists, and browsing behavior based on contextual terms.

Read full review Alternatives Considered StackAdapt is significantly less expensive than
The Trade Desk . StackAdapt doesn't have campaign minimums, unlike
The Trade Desk , meaning you can experiment with a lower ad spend to gain client confidence before investing at a larger level. Plus they don't lock you into an annual contract or anything long term. It feels very similar to
The Trade Desk but without the high contract.
Read full review Outbrain doesn't charge a fee for automatic credit card billing. Often
Outbrain CPC for the same content is cheaper but not always. The
Outbrain UX is not as good as Taboola but recent changes had made them better than they used to be. In
Outbrain you can not change images or titles once they are submitted. You also can not clone campaigns which you can do with Taboola
